      Among the diverse movies included in this celebration of the decade are A Fish Called Wanda, The Last Temptation of Christ, Amadeus, Platoon, Who Framed Roger Rabbit, and Dangerous Liaisons. For every film discussed, Brode provides a listing of casts and credits and a detailed summary of the film's story and production history. Hundreds of photographs.

    • Exploring the rise of femme fatales in cinema during the 1960s and 1970s, this book highlights a diverse array of captivating characters, from James Bond's villains to mythical queens and seductive vampires. It captures the era's cultural shift towards more liberated representations of women on screen, showcasing their allure and danger. Featuring rare photographs and insights into the lives of the actresses who portrayed these iconic figures, the work serves as a comprehensive encyclopedia of their cinematic and personal narratives.

      Exploring the realm of science fiction cinema, this book presents a curated list of the one hundred greatest sci-fi films, showcasing a diverse range from contemporary hits like Guardians of the Galaxy and Gravity to lesser-known classics and overlooked masterpieces. Each entry offers insights and revelations that will intrigue even the most dedicated fans, highlighting the genre's evolution and its impact on film history.

      Focusing on the cinematic portrayal of World War II, this encyclopedia provides an extensive illustrated guide to both English-language and international films related to the conflict. It explores the origins of the war, starting with events leading up to the U.S. involvement in December 1941, and delves into significant battles and moments that shaped the narrative. Additionally, it examines the war's aftermath and how filmmakers have depicted this complex historical period across different regions.

    • The film legacy of John Wayne is examined through the lens of his portrayals of Western archetypes and American masculinity. Doug Brode offers insightful commentary and reflections on the lessons derived from Wayne's characters, supported by quotes and photographs from his films. This exploration is particularly engaging for fans of John Wayne and enthusiasts of Western cinema, highlighting the cultural significance and enduring impact of his work.
